Output f6da81de02b3c3b157a76753add3f65b7a02c54012f0cc2e356511f767e80ffd:0

value
17412000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c68803d5154723e8da6dfe89d13998bfe781802 OP_EQUAL
address
32pdDhSPLfkqiXRnt3E1qSaZweFPsecYoK
transaction
f6da81de02b3c3b157a76753add3f65b7a02c54012f0cc2e356511f767e80ffd
spent
true